So how do you know how much life insurance you need? This article will help you understand the importance of life insurance and how to determine your life insurance needs. First, consider who needs to be insured and their financial responsibilities.
If you have a spouse, kids, elderly parents, or a business partner, make sure their needs are accounted for should anything happen to you. Next, calculate your total expenses and debts.
This includes everyday living expenses and any larger payments like a mortgage or student loan. Finally, factor in any additional liabilities, such as a business loan, and your life insurance amount should cover these.

Calculating Coverage Amount
Figuring out how much life insurance you need to adequately protect your family can be a perplexing endeavor. The best approach to take is to calculate the right coverage amount based on your specific situation.
But how do you do this? Start by taking into account any existing life insurance policies or death benefits that you may have. Then, consider factors such as your age, the size of your family, your current income and debts, your short- and long-term financial goals, and any special needs of your beneficiaries.
